Ticket: Scrubwell drift — prod vs repo

EXIF scrubbing on the Pellan upload path is stripping GPS but not serial fields in prod. Repo config says otherwise. Someone patched the host directly. On-call: reconcile tonight, redeploy from repo, verify with a test upload. Prod currently shows these values.

config for kafof-bawef:
holath:
  log_level: debug
  metrics_host: metrics.holath.qorvelsys.internal
  pin: 2191
  pool_size: 32

## Authentication

Hey support folks — the FareSplit pricing experiment runs behind our internal Tollbooth gateway, so every request needs a key in the header. Don't reuse your personal sandbox creds; the experiment bucketing breaks if you do. For quick lookups on a customer's variant assignment, just use the shared read-only key below.

gateway credential: kto3_qfe

## Auth

The Fernvale reminder job pings patients the evening before their appointment. It talks to our internal messaging gateway, Larkpost, which wants a key on every request via the X-Larkpost-Key header. Don't use your personal creds — the job runs under a shared service identity. The key you'll need for local testing is right below.

API key for yahig-tadup: kto7_ubizbYm